When the time comes to teach your child about crossing the road, remember the following: 1. always set a good example by choosing a safe place to cross and explaining what you're doing 2. let your child help you decide where and when it's safe to cross 3. tell your child that it's safest to cross at a pedestrian crossing or a crossing patrol 4. tell your child not to cross where they can't see far along the road 5. explain that they should not try to cross a road between parked cars; drivers won't be able to see them … Another habit that leads to accidents is being engaged in gadgets while walking on the road. The Centers for Disease Control found that toddlers are most often hit by cars in driveways, preschoolers are hit by cars when they cross the street in between parked cars, and school-aged children are most hit when they cross in the middle of the block. ...
